My Red Baron onions are a complete range of sizes though so far none of the leaves are dying back .
Bearing in mind the terrible weather of late and the fact that we are well into Sept., when is the best time to pull them out the ground in order to dry and store them.

onions have been hit badly by wet this year . we had to pull ours early due to this so if they have a bulb thats usable then pull and lay them in a dry breezy place on racks or something to dry  try to turn them over every couple of days so that the air gets to all of them,  dont over lap leaves if you can . when the leaves get crispy and fall away store them in open weave sacks or baskets use any up that show signs of rot first :wink:
